Jesús del Castillo y Angulo (Chucho)

Biographical Information[edit]

Jesús Castillo was a catcher in the early days of the Mexican League, before statistical records are available. He was the backstop for Policía del Distrito Federal when they won the 1928 title, the 4th championship. He also won Mexican League titles with Obras Públicas de México (1931), Tigres de Comintra (1933), Agrario de México (1935 and 1936) for five pennants in nine seasons. He also played for the Mexican national team in the 1930 Central American Games. He hit .250/?/.375 with 3 runs in 4 games as the main catcher for the Silver Medalists. Fielding .931 at catcher, he led all backstops in the tournament with six assists. He also played for Mexico in the 1938 Central American and Caribbean Games,
